Check out the comments left by our users about this financial (Utah Title Loans Inc). The 90% users who leave an opinion of this financial, live within 7KM. In our database Cedar City has this college at 6801 South State St
Cedar City, UT 84720. According to the citizens of Cedar City, this financial has good references.
List your lived experience in this financial (Utah Title Loans Inc) for other users to see.